-
Posts
13 -
Joined
-
Last visited
Content Type
Profiles
Forums
Calendar
Posts posted by 127486
-
-
К сожалению с данной прошивкой результат тотже.
-
-
Ну вот опять бьюсь весь день, ни какого результата положительного не достиг.
-
версия прошивки 4.1 Build 07061517
-
По предыдущему случаю - есть подозрение, что ответ на запрос настолько быстр, что NE-4110A не успевает переключиться с передачи на приём. Только вот как это поправить...
С NE-4100T такой проблемы нету, на том же оборудовании.
Отличает только то что NE-4100T работает через http://www.ti.com/lit/ds/symlink/iso3088.pdf , но при этом UPort 1130 и
CP-132I работают безупречно.Если рассматривать проблему прошивки, то что мне дальше делать?
Где взять поправленную прошивку?
-
Добрый день.
У меня такая же проблема, один в один.
Принимает с ошибками.
При чем с UPort1130 и NE-4100T все работает замечательно.
Эксперименты с задержкой положительного результата не принесли.
Работаю в режиме RealComMode.
-
Все здравствуйте.
Суть следующая, подключаем АЦП по 485 через UPort1130, часто приходится пробежаться по всем USB портам пока пойдет связь с программой сбора, как только любой из USB портов нормально начал работать, то тогда можно уже ставить в любой другой и все будет ОК.
Сейчас по совету менеджера, взял UPort 1150, бьемся уже третьи сутки и ни как не можем заставить его нормально работать, на UPort 1150 лампочка TXD мигает, но до устройства эти данные не доходят, так как там индикатор молчит.
Операционка Windows XP SP3 (32).
Если поменять местами A и В, то индикаторы RxD и TxD горят постоянно, значит физически устройства друг друга видят.
Подозреваю что проблема всетаки с драйверами, в Ports Configuration соответствующие настройки делаем.
Кто сталкивался с подобным?
-
Проблема решена.
UPort 1130 в отличие от RSX1-4 не принимает пакет целиком а шлет его побайтно, в результате получается что каждый байт виден как первый.
Совет для программистов при приеме нужно указывать точное количество байт, тогда все будет ОК.
ComPort.ReadStr(Str, "количество байт"); количество байт.
-
При чем запрос на АЦП проходит нормально а ответ приходит не кррректно.
-
Добрый день,
Уточните, пожалуйста, что за АЦП подключается к UPort 1130. Возможно, у нас есть какие-то готовые рецепты работы с этим оборудованием.
Удавалось ли опросить АЦП через порты RS-485, созданные на базе других устройств (не UPort)?
АЦП преобразует в полудуплексный стандарт связи RS485, его схема представлена на рис. 1. В АЦП входят микроконтроллер AdUC 836 и преобразователь интерфейса ADМ483 (0-5) в.
АЦП без проблем опрашивалось конвертером rsx1-4 его схема представлена на rsx1-4_sc.pdf.
Параметры порта в программе опроса.
BaudRate - br19200
Bufer - InputSize 254
Bufer - OutputSize 254
DataBits - dbEight
DiscardNull - False
EventChar - #32
evRxChar - true
evTxEmpty - false
evRxFlags - false
evRing - false
evBreak - false
evCTS - false
evDSR - false
evError - false
evRLSD - false
evRx80Full - false
ControlDTR -dtrEnable
ControlRTS - rtsDisable
DSRSensitivity - false
FlowControl - fcNone
OutCTSFlow - false
OutDSRFlow - false
TxContinueOnXoff - False
XoffChar - #254
XonChar - #254
XonXoffln - false
XonXoffOut - false
Bits - prNone
Check - false
Replase - false
ReplaseChar - #254
StopBits - sbOneStopBit
SyncMetod - smThreadSync
Tag - 32
ReadInterval - 100 ms
readTotalConstant - 100 ms
readTotalMultiplier - 100 ms
WriteTotalConstant - 1 ms
WriteTotalMultiplier - 1 ms
С данными параметрами rsx1-4 работает отлично.
За раннее спасибо.
-
Проблема оказалась в USB hub через который подключались UPort 1130, именно по этому искажались данные по терминалу.
Но с АЦП так и осталась, думаю что проблема с таймаутами.
Буду разбираться дальше.
-
Подключил два устройства UPort 1130, через терминал отправляю hAA и получаю на втором h15, а должен получать то же что и отправлял, такая картина наблюдается в обеих направлениях.
В чем может быть проблема? Все возможные настройки перепробовал
возможно ли увеличить буфер для Nport5130 на отправку в режиме работы TCP Client
in Преобразователи RS-232/422/485 в Ethernet
Posted
Здравствуйте
Можно ли как-то увеличить размер буфера (Packet length) более 1024 байт? Нужно отправить один пакет разом более 1024 байт. Зачем есть такое ограничение? Неужели не хватает памяти проца в moxa ?
Спасибо.